  • Using the SYS account

    Dear all,

    My database is Oracle 10 g on Windows platform.

    Due to certain requirements (DBAs) checks must use our accounts indivisual instead of SYS.

    I want to confirm if I assign SYSDBA, s/n, RESOURCES, CONNECT to a user it will get all the privileges that the SYS user have? I think I will be fine.

    The second condition is now, if I get all the privileges in my own account who is saying "IMRAN" than will be using the SYS account. It can be disabled?

    Thank you and best regards.

    SYS cannot be disabled.  Cannot delete SYSDBA privilege.  Any person who is granted the SYSDBA privilege and made a connection with "AS SYSDBA" actually connects under the SYS, not his named account account.

    Therefore,.

    a: I would not grant SYSDBA to named users

    b. I would lock in a safe accessible only by a manager the "oracle" account (and any other account in the OSDBA group)

    c. ask the DBA using the DBA role (or a custom, more restrictive role)

    d. to request the account 'oracle' only for STARTUP, SHUTDOWN, RESTORE/RECOVERY and patch.  (assuming backups are automated scripted jobs)

    Hemant K Collette

  • How to use the Update Manager

    I'm going to update ESXi 5.5 hosts my cluster but I know Update Manager component, so I ask if it is possible to host unique patch so that I can test VM on it and then to extend the update to the other guests.

    Can you offer me to apply all updates or it is usually to give priority to the security updates? I use Vmware image of HP because my hosts are server blades Proliant.

    How can I start? You have to suggest the quick start guide?

    Update Manager downloads the list of patches available from vmware.com. To configure the frequency of the update of the repository, click on House. Click the Update Manager icon. On the Configuration tab, click Patch download calendar.

    To view the scheduled task Patch download, click Homepage > scheduled tasks > VMware vCenter Update Manager Update to download.


    Notes:

    • To manually run this task, right-click the task, click run.

    • When you run the task, see task Download Patch definitions in the these last tasks.

    • If the download Patch definitions task fails, make sure that Update Manager can reach vmware.com. For more information

    To set baselines to the ESX host:

    1. Click home > hosts and Clusters.

    2. Highlight the ESX host, you want to update, and then click the Update Manager .

    3. Click on Attach. Select host patches critical and not critical host patches of baselines, and then click attach.

      Note: to create basic custom lines click home > Update Manager > planning and groups > Create.

    To analyze the ESX host for missing patches on the repository, right-click on the ESX host and click find updates > patches and Extensions > Scan.

    Notes:

    • Scan progress is displayed by The entity of Scan task in the recent tasks.

    • The analysis of the host does not affect running virtual machines.

    • If parsing fails, make sure that the ports between Update Manager and the ESX host is open. For more information, seerequirements of ports network VMware Update Manager (1004543).

    • When the analysis is complete, you will see the number of missing patches on the ESX host. If some patches are missing, you see Compliant.

    To restore the missing patches to the ESX host:

    1. Turn off all the virtual machines or vMotion them to another ESX host.
    2. Place the ESX host in maintenance mode. Right click on the ESX host, choose to enter the Maintenance Modeand click on Yes.
    3. Right-click on the ESX host and choose clean > host patches critical and not critical host patches of baselines, and then click Next.
    4. Choose which updates or patches to install, click Next > Next > Finish.

    Notes:

    • Progress of sanitation are illustrated by the task of the principal remedy in the recent tasks.

    • This task could take some time as Update Manager starts to download the patches to the vmware.com website.

    • If the restore fails, ensure that Update Manager, ESX host, and vmware.com ports are open. For more information, see requirements of ports network VMware Update Manager (1004543).

  • The ESX host could restart after complete rehabilitation.

  • How to restore the once installed ESXi patches

    How to restore the once installed ESXi patches

    If you have already updated, restore to the latest version:

    1. Restart the ESXi host
    2. Loading at startup the hypervisor progress bar, press SHIFT+R.
    3. The following warning is displayed: current hypervisor will be permanently replaced
      with the construction: XXXXXX - x.x.x. are you sure? [Y/n]
    4. Press SHIFT+is to roll back the build
    5. Press Enter to start
